Aardman seeks game developer intern

By May 20, 2014 TIGA News

Game Developer Internship

http://www.aardman.com/about-us/jobs/game-developer-internship-2/ 

3 Month Fixed Term Contract – June – Sept 2014 (there is some flexibility with this)
Salary circa £16,000 per annum pro rata
Gas Ferry Road, Bristol

Aardman’s Digital Department is responsible for creating engaging interactive experiences to the same high quality as the animations we are renowned for. These include online and mobile games, websites online marketing and social media campaigns both for our own characters and external clients such as the BBC, Tate, Pan Macmillan, and Cartoon Network.

This is an exciting opportunity to get a foot in the door in the games and digital industry within an award-winning creative company. You will be working alongside experienced Flash, Unity and HTML5 developers, supporting in the production of online and mobile games, websites, social media campaigns and other interactive entertainment content.

We’re looking for candidates who have completed a minimum 2 years of degree (or similar) in coding based subject having learnt and explored different programming languages in a creative context. Experience in developing games and level design is required, however this can be personal projects, we are not necessarily expecting commercial experience. An understanding and experience of developing in a minimum of one of the following: Unity3D; HTML5, CSS and JS; Adobe AIR and Flash. C++ would also be useful. Strong pride in the quality of coding and producing work of a consistently high standard is required with a reasonable knowledge of working with Adobe Photoshop. An ambition to work in the digital industry, particularly in gaming is a must.
